Unauthorised development - converted garage
Im hoping you can advise me on this query. A friend of mine bought a house a few years ago, the garage was already converted into a bedroom. He recently renovated the house and extended the (garage) bedroom to include a kitchen and living area. He got planning permission for this. There is only one main entrance door into house. Inside main door is a door to main house and a door to the bedroom/kitchen/living area'. He now got a letter from council stating possible unauthorised development and they need to inspect the building. Anyone had a similar experience or point of view on this?

Re: Unauthorised development - converted garage
Is the room / kitchen / living area being let out?
Was there a condition in the Planning Permission regarding occupying the house as a single dwelling unit?
